Aninos, Elias J.

  • Tuesday, January 4, 2005

Elias J. Aninos, 78, of Ringgold, formerly of Michigan, died Wednesday, December 29, 2004, at his residence.

He was a former Detroit Police Officer for 17 years and was most recently a finish carpenter for many years. Mr. Aninos was a member of St. Gerard’s Catholic Church and was a veteran of World War II serving in the U. S. Navy.

He was preceded in death by a brother, Edward Aninos, and sister, Josephine Cantrell.

He is survived by his wife, Barbara A. Aninos; son, Paul A. (Sally) Aninos, Plymouth, MI; daughter, Karen (William) Bidwell, Livonia, MI; step-daughter, Debra (Paul) Foster, Chattanooga; brother, Nicholas Aninos, Florida; sister, Catherine (Joseph) Rossi, Venice, FL; four grandchildren; three step-grandchildren, and several nieces and nephews.
